Why LFP Cell Costs Are Falling

Let's cut to the chase: LFP battery prices have dropped 38% since 2020 according to BloombergNEF, but why should you care? Well, imagine this - your neighbor installed solar+storage last year paying $150/kWh, while today's lithium iron phosphate cells hover around $97/kWh. That's not just pocket change; it's a fundamental shift in energy economics.

Three tectonic forces are reshaping the market:

  • China's scaled production (they control 79% of LFP manufacturing)
  • Improved cathode stabilization techniques
  • Automakers like Tesla betting big on LFP for mass-market EVs

Wait, no—correction. It's actually 82% Chinese market share as of Q2 2024. These numbers matter because LFP cell costs directly impact your ROI timeline. At Highjoule Technologies, we've seen commercial clients break even 18 months faster compared to 2021 installations.

Beyond Price Tags - Lifetime Value

Let's get real for a second. Anyone still comparing LFP battery prices to NMC alternatives is missing the forest for the trees. Consider:

  • 80% residual value after 10 years vs NMC's 45%
  • Zero cobalt supply chain risks
  • Wider temperature tolerance (-30°C to 60°C)

A recent DOE study found LFP systems outperforming projections in 89% of industrial applications. Your Move, Smart Buyer

The market's flooded with "cheap" LFP options, but here's the rub - not all cells meet UL1973 certifications. We've seen 23% capacity variance in off-brand imports. Our advice? Demand third-party test reports. Better yet, ask suppliers about their cell matching tolerance. Highjoule guarantees <1% variance across parallel strings - crucial for maximizing pack longevity.
